Understanding Voice-Over Transitions in Audiobook Production

A voice-over transition is the invisible seam between two audio segments in an audiobook. These segments might represent different narrators, character voices, chapter breaks, or corrected takes from a pickup session. The goal is to create a listening experience so seamless that the audience never detects editing has occurred. Smooth transitions preserve narrative flow and emotional continuity, which keeps listeners immersed in the story for hours at a time. Poor transitions — sudden volume shifts, background noise changes, unnatural pauses, or audible clicks — jolt the audience out of the story and undermine the narrator's performance.

Transitions do more than hide edits. They also shape pacing. A longer fade between chapters signals a break and gives the listener a moment to reflect. A quick crossfade between two lines keeps energy high during an action sequence. A deliberate pause before a dramatic reveal builds tension. Understanding how these techniques affect the listener's experience separates polished audiobook production from amateur work.

Pre-Recording Preparation for Smoother Transitions

The best transitions are planned before recording begins. While post-production editing can fix many issues, careful preparation reduces the amount of work required later and produces cleaner results. Investing time in setup and planning pays dividends in the quality of the final product.

Establish a Consistent Recording Environment

Choose a quiet, acoustically treated room and maintain consistent microphone distance, gain settings, and recording position throughout every session. Even minor changes in room tone — the ambient hiss or hum of your recording space — become obvious when two clips are joined. The human ear is remarkably sensitive to changes in background noise, especially in quiet passages.

Record a reference track at the start of each session: a few seconds of silence followed by a short spoken phrase. Use this reference to match background noise levels when editing later. If you must record across multiple sessions, capture 10 to 15 seconds of room tone each time. This gives you filler material and noise profile samples for noise reduction software. Store these room tone files in a labeled folder so they are easy to access during editing.

Plan Natural Break Points

Work with the narrator to identify natural pauses in the text. End of paragraphs, sentence boundaries, and points where a thought concludes all make ideal cut points. Avoid splitting a sentence mid-flow. Even with careful editing, cutting within a phrase often sounds choppy because the natural speech rhythm is interrupted.

For books with multiple narrators, plan clear handoff signals. Words like "said," "replied," or "asked" provide natural transition points between voices. Mark these spots in the script so the editor knows where cuts are intended. For single-narrator books, mark chapter breaks and section breaks as primary edit points. Secondary edit points can be placed at paragraph breaks where the narrator takes a natural breath.

Record Multiple Takes with Overlap

When re-recording a line or correcting a mistake, record a few extra words before and after the error. This overlap gives you flexibility to fade in and out at natural-sounding points rather than at arbitrary splice locations. Many professionals record pickup sessions using the identical microphone and recording chain as the original session. They then edit the new sentence into the existing track, using the overlap to create a smooth transition.

Label your takes clearly. Use a naming convention that includes the chapter, page number, and take number. This organization saves hours of searching during post-production and reduces the risk of using the wrong take.

Core Editing Techniques for Seamless Transitions

Once clean recordings are captured, the editing process begins. These core techniques form the foundation of professional audiobook editing. Master them before moving on to more advanced methods.

Crossfading

Crossfading overlaps the end of one clip with the beginning of another. A fade-out is applied to the first clip and a fade-in to the second. The length of the crossfade determines its effect. Too short — around 1 millisecond — does nothing to hide the edit point. Too long — 500 milliseconds or more — creates an unnatural dip in audio volume that sounds like a drop in the signal.

For most speech, a crossfade of 10 to 30 milliseconds works well. Use shorter fades for fast-paced dialogue where quick transitions maintain energy. Use longer fades for chapter endings, quiet reflective passages, or transitions between scenes. Most digital audio workstations (DAWs) include a crossfade tool that automates this process. Learning to adjust crossfade length by ear and by waveform inspection is a critical skill.

Consistent Audio Levels

Volume mismatches are the most common giveaway of an edit. When two clips have different loudness levels, the transition sounds jarring even if the content matches perfectly. Normalize your entire narration project to a target loudness. For audiobooks, the standard is typically -16 LUFS (Loudness Units relative to Full Scale) with a true peak of no higher than -3 dB. This matches distribution platform requirements and ensures consistent playback across devices.

Use a level meter to compare the RMS (root mean square) energy of adjacent clips. If one clip is slightly louder, apply gain reduction to match the surrounding audio before adding the crossfade. Pay attention to peaks as well. A breath, plosive, or sibilant sound that spikes in volume can make an edit audible. Use compression or manual volume automation to smooth those peaks before the transition point.

Matching Background Noise and Room Tone

Even in a well-controlled recording environment, subtle variations in noise floor occur. Temperature changes, equipment warm-up, and environmental shifts all contribute. To match room tone across transitions, use one of these approaches:

Method 1: Copy and Paste Room Tone — During editing, copy a short section of silence from the first clip and paste it onto a separate track underneath the second clip. This overlays identical room tone across the transition point. Apply a crossfade to the room tone layer itself to avoid a pop when the loop starts or ends.

Method 2: Noise Reduction Matching — Use noise reduction software to analyze the noise profile of each clip and reduce differences. Apply the same noise reduction settings to both clips to create a consistent noise floor.

Method 3: Ambient Bed — Extract a noise profile from a silent portion of the recording and loop it throughout the entire file. Use this as a background layer beneath the narration. This technique ensures all transitions share the same noise profile. The ambient bed should be very low in volume — barely audible — so it does not compete with the narration.

Timing and Rhythm

Speech has inherent rhythm: pauses between words, breaths at phrase boundaries, and the cadence of sentences. When editing, preserve this natural timing. If you remove a stumble, also remove the associated breath or pause to avoid leaving a lingering silence that sounds unnatural. If you cut a line and the next line starts too abruptly, insert a tiny silence — 50 to 150 milliseconds — to simulate a natural breath or pause.

Use the waveform view to identify where breaths and pauses occur. Look for gaps in the waveform that correspond to silence or low-level noise. Adjust these to match the surrounding speech. Timing adjustments of even 10 milliseconds can make the difference between a natural-sounding edit and an awkward one. Train your ear to hear these subtle differences by listening to your edits at normal speed and then again at half speed.

Advanced Techniques for Professional Results

Once core techniques are mastered, advanced editors use specialized methods to achieve even greater precision. These techniques require practice but deliver superior results.

Equal Power versus Equal Gain Crossfades

Equal-gain crossfades maintain total volume by summing two clips with a linear fade shape. This can cause a perceived dip in volume if the audio phase is different between clips. Equal-power crossfades maintain perceived loudness by using a curved fade shape. This is ideal for music or sustained tones where volume consistency matters.

For speech, equal-gain crossfades are usually sufficient and simpler to apply. However, experiment with both types to see which sounds smoother for your specific audio. Some DAWs allow you to switch between crossfade types, and the difference can be subtle but meaningful.

Volume Automation

Rather than applying a fixed crossfade, draw volume automation curves manually. This gives you fine control over the transition shape. For example, you can leave one voice slightly louder and gradually fade it out while the other fades in, mimicking a natural handoff in a dialogue scene. Automation also allows you to duck background noise or breaths at the exact transition point.

Volume automation is particularly useful for transitions between different narrators or character voices. Adjust the fade shape to match the emotional tone of the scene. A slower fade-out with a quick fade-in can create a sense of interruption, while equal fade rates suggest a natural handoff.

Spectral Editing

Tools that display audio as a spectrogram reveal frequency mismatches that are invisible in waveform view. You can see sudden loss of high-end sibilance, a low-frequency rumble, or a mid-range bump that makes two clips sound different. Use EQ matching or spectral repair to blend the two clips before the transition.

For example, if one clip has more 200 Hz hum, notch it out before the transition. If another clip lacks high-frequency presence, apply gentle high-shelf EQ boost. Matching the spectral content of adjacent clips makes transitions virtually undetectable.

Editing with Time Compression and Expansion

Sometimes two clips have slightly different speaking rates, making them difficult to join smoothly. Time compression or expansion tools allow you to adjust the timing of one clip to match the other. Use these tools sparingly and with careful listening. Changes of more than 5 percent often introduce audible artifacts like warbling or pitch distortion.

Apply time adjustments to silent sections or breath pauses rather than to spoken words. This preserves the natural sound of the voice while correcting timing mismatches.

Essential Software and Tools for Audiobook Editing

While any DAW can edit audiobooks, certain tools offer features that simplify smooth transitions and improve workflow efficiency.

  • Audacity — Free and open-source. Its crossfade tool, noise reduction, and clip normalization are ideal for beginners. The Audacity Crossfade Clips manual provides detailed instructions. Audacity also supports plug-in extensions for additional functionality.
  • Adobe Audition — Industry standard with multitrack editing, automatic speech alignment, and essential sound effects. The Auto Heal Selection tool applies quick crossfades with adjustable parameters. The Essential Sound panel includes presets for spoken word that simplify level matching.
  • Reaper — Powerful and affordable. Supports custom actions for batch crossfade and item fades. The Reaper User Guide includes sections on transition techniques. Reaper's scripting capability allows you to automate repetitive tasks.
  • iZotope RX — Specialized for audio repair. The Mouth De-click tool removes clicks and pops that disrupt transitions. Spectral De-noise analyzes and reduces background noise differences between clips. Voice De-noise targets breath sounds and mouth noises without affecting the speech.
  • TwistedWave — Online editor with simple fade tools. Good for quick edits when you need to check a transition on the go. The batch processing feature applies consistent settings across multiple files.

Choose software that fits your budget and workflow. Learning one DAW thoroughly is more valuable than having superficial knowledge of several. Invest time in mastering the crossfade and automation tools in your chosen software.

Common Pitfalls and Practical Solutions

Even experienced editors encounter problems with transitions. Recognizing these issues and knowing how to fix them saves time and improves results.

Audible Dip in Volume Mid-Sentence

A crossfade sometimes causes a noticeable drop in loudness, making the audio sound like it fades out and then back in. This occurs when the crossfade length is too long or when the phase relationship between clips causes cancellation.

Solution: Use an equal-power crossfade instead of equal-gain. Shorten the fade length to 10 to 15 milliseconds. Alternatively, bypass the crossfade entirely and use volume automation. Ramp up the second clip slightly before the first ends, creating a smooth handoff without a dip.

Artificial-Sounding Breath

Inserting a breath from a different take often results in a sound that does not match. The breath might be too loud, too quiet, or the wrong type for the emotional context.

Solution: Use a breath from the same recording session whenever possible. If you must synthesize a breath, fade in a short noise burst that matches the length and intensity of surrounding breaths. Match the breath to the emotional tone — a slow sigh for reflection, a quick gasp for surprise. Layer the breath beneath the narration at a level that feels natural.

Room Tone Mismatch

A subtle "whoosh" or change in background noise at the edit point reveals a room tone mismatch. This is especially noticeable in quiet passages where the noise floor is more apparent.

Solution: Record a valid room tone sample of 10 to 15 seconds during each recording session. Paste this sample over the transition on a separate track. Apply a crossfade to the room tone layer itself to avoid a pop at the loop point. The crossfade on the room tone should be longer than the crossfade on the narration to ensure smooth blending.

Pop or Click at the Edit Point

A pop or click occurs when there is a DC offset or a sharp waveform discontinuity at the edit point. This is common when cutting at a point where the waveform is not at zero crossing.

Solution: Apply a fade-in of 1 to 2 milliseconds to the beginning of the second clip. Zoom into the waveform and find the exact zero-crossing point to cut there. Most DAWs have a tool that snaps edits to zero crossings automatically. Use this feature to prevent pops.

Mismatched Speaking Pace

When combining takes from different recording sessions, the narrator's speaking pace may vary slightly. This creates a noticeable change in rhythm at the transition point.

Solution: Use time compression or expansion to adjust the pace of one clip to match the other. Apply changes of no more than 3 to 5 percent to avoid artifacts. Focus timing adjustments on pauses and breaths rather than on spoken words to preserve vocal quality.

Plosive Distortion at Transition

A plosive sound like "p" or "b" at the beginning of the second clip can cause a thump that reveals the edit.

Solution: Use a high-pass filter to reduce low-frequency energy in the plosive. Apply a gentle fade-in of 3 to 5 milliseconds to the beginning of the second clip. If the plosive is severe, replace it with a plosive from another take that matches the same word or sound.

Building a Workflow for Consistent Transitions

Developing a systematic workflow ensures consistent results across long projects. A typical audiobook of 10 hours might contain hundreds of transitions. A reliable process prevents fatigue-related mistakes.

Pre-Editing Phase

Listen to the entire recording once without editing. Note sections that require pickup or correction. Mark natural transition points in the script. Organize files into labeled folders by chapter and take number. Set up your DAW project with consistent track templates that include room tone layers, crossfade presets, and level meters.

Editing Phase

Work through the project in sections. Apply crossfades and level matching as you go. Listen to each transition at normal speed and then at half speed to detect subtle issues. Use spectral analysis to check for frequency mismatches. Save your project file frequently with version numbers to avoid data loss.

Quality Control Phase

After completing the edit, listen to the entire audiobook from start to finish. Note any transitions that still sound problematic. Pay attention to chapter breaks, scene changes, and points where different narrators interact. Use headphones and speakers to check transitions on different playback systems. Correct any remaining issues before final export.

Export and Validation

Export the final audio in the required format, typically MP3 at 192 kbps or 256 kbps for audiobook distribution. Validate the file against platform requirements. Check that loudness meets the -16 LUFS target and that true peaks do not exceed -3 dB. Verify that the file length matches the expected runtime.
